Donald John Trump (born June 14, 1946) is the 45th and current president of the United States. Before entering politics, he was a businessman and television personality. Trump was born and raised in Queens, a borough of New York City, and received a bachelor's degree in economics from the Wharton School. He took charge of his family's real-estate business in 1971, renamed it The Trump Organization, and expanded its operations from Queens and Brooklyn into Manhattan. The company built or renovated skyscrapers, hotels, casinos, and golf courses. Trump later started various side ventures, mostly by licensing his name. He bought the Miss Universe brand of beauty pageants in 1996, and sold it in 2015. He produced and hosted The Apprentice, a reality television series, from 2003 to 2015. As of 2020, Forbes estimated his net worth to be $2.1 billion.[

Clairo releases new track ‘For Now’ to raise funds for trans support and the end of gun violence

Reading now: 352
nme.com

Clairo has shared the demo of a new song called ‘For Now’, with all proceeds going to two non-profit organisations.Apart from appearing on a remix of Phoenix‘s ‘After Midnight’ last month, Clairo hasn’t released any new music since she shared her 2021 album ‘Sling’.However yesterday (April 1), Clairo took to social media to announce she was sharing a demo of an unreleased track called ‘For Now’.

The song is available to download from Bandcamp for $1 (81p) now and all proceeds will be split between the non-profits For The Gworls and Everytown.

For The Gworls raises money to “assist with Black trans folks’ rent and affirmative surgeries” while Everytown “are a movement of parents, students, survivors, educators, gun owners & concerned citizens fighting to end gun violence and build safer communities.”Check out the demo of ‘For Now’ here.A post shared by Claire Cottrill (@clairo)The delicate, piano-driven track sees Clairo focusing on the present, as she confesses her love “until it all breaks down”.Late last year, Clairo wrapped up touring in support of ‘Sling’ with a message that said, “thanks for an amazing year.

We’ll see you again whenever I’ve made another album.”Earlier this year, it was confirmed Clairo would be playing a series of gigs as part of the new Re:Set concert series.
